Abstract

The purpose of the study was to describe the feasibility of discovery learning based student worksheets in science learning for fifth grade students, to find out student responses to discovery learning based student worksheets in science learning to improve cognitive learning outcomes and science process skills of fifth grade students, to determine the effectiveness of using sheets the work of students based on discovery learning in science learning to improve cognitive learning outcomes and science process skills of class V students. This type of research uses Research and Development (R&D) a process to develop new products or improve existing products so that they can be accounted for. the application of an R & D approach with the method ADDIE. The integration of the discovery learning model in the worksheet elements of students has paid attention to the limitations of students' rational thinking abilities, especially elementary school age students. to help improve cognitive learning outcomes and science process skills using discovery learning models. The questions used were cognitive questions and science process skills questions used for assessment. The difficulty of developing student worksheets based on discovery learning in science learning is at the design stage, especially choosing striking colors on the background and choosing good pictures. With further research, it is necessary to prepare pictures that will be used to support student worksheets.

Abstract

The purpose of this study is to determine the feasibility of material, language, design, student response, and product effectiveness resulting from the development of e-modules based on the RME approach using traditional Bengkulu cakes to improve problem solving skills in flat shape material for class IV SD. This research is a Research and Development (R&D) study. The model used in the development is the 4-D model. The subjects in the study were students of SDN 53 Kaur, which consisted of 12 students in class IV A as the control class, and 13 students in class IV B as the experimental class. The instruments used in this study were interview guideline, questionnaires, and problem-solving test questions in the form of essay for pretest and posttest. The data analysis technique used Aiken's V, Interrater Reliability, normality test, homogeneity test, t-test and N-gain score. From the research results it is known that the results of material, language, and design validation, as well as student responses to the use of e-modules are very feasible and well used in learning so that students are motivated to learn.

Abstract

This study aims to determine the feasibility of the material, language, design, student response, and the effectiveness of the product resulting from the development of an RME-based e-module using the Bubungan Lima traditional house to improve understanding of concepts in elementary school mathematics learning. This research is a Research and Development (R&D) study. The model used in development is the ADDIE model. The subjects in the study were students of SDN 82 Bengkulu City, totaling 22 students in class IV D as the control class, and 22 students in class IV B as the experimental class. The instruments used in this study were interview guides, questionnaires, and conceptual understanding tests in the form of essay questions through pretest and posttest. To measure the effectiveness of conceptual understanding, tests were carried out before and after learning took place in the experimental class and the control class. The data analysis technique in this study was validation analysis using Aiken's V, Interrater Reliability, student responses, and t-test. From the research results it is known that the results of material, language, and design validation, as well as teacher and student responses to e-modules are very feasible and well used in learning. The result of the Significance value is 0.00 which is smaller than α = 0.05. Based on the gain-score test from the use of the e-module, it gives a moderate gain score of 48%. So that the understanding of the mathematical concepts of students who use e-modules based on the RME model using the Bubungan Lima traditional house is higher than students who only use textbooks from school so that it is declared effective.
